A Graduate Certificate in Health App User Satisfaction Surveys equips you with the skills to design, administer, and analyze surveys focused on improving the user experience of health applications. You'll master methodologies crucial for evaluating the effectiveness and usability of mHealth technologies.
Learning outcomes typically include proficiency in survey design principles tailored to the healthcare context, statistical analysis techniques relevant to user feedback, and the ability to interpret survey results to inform app development and enhancement. You'll also gain expertise in qualitative data analysis methods.
The duration of such a certificate program varies, but commonly ranges from a few months to a year, depending on the institution and the intensity of the coursework. Many programs offer flexible online learning options, accommodating working professionals.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ance, addressing the growing demand for user-centered design in the rapidly expanding health app market. Graduates are well-prepared for roles in UX research, health informatics, and product management within healthcare organizations and technology companies developing mobile health solutions.
